One of the machines I run is an old Tsugami swiss with a Fanuc LE control. It similar to a 16i. Anyways the machine is from 96' and most of the time when its powered down it it has this problem:
When you power it back up all the servo motors power up in alarm state (all 7). The alarm says "401 Servo motor: vrdy off".
from reading the manual the Vrdy is the ready signal it sends to the control. anyways this is very annoying as the machine must be powered off any time you hit Estop. id say 60% of the time when you power it back up it has this problem. The only thing you can do to fix this is wait or power it on and off repeatedly which is very annoying.
